This study delves into the intricate relationship between elementary math learning and Jean Piaget’s cognitive development stages. Employing an integrative literature review, meta-analysis, and an exploration of implications for mathematics education, we unveil significant insights into the world of mathematical cognition. In the preoperational stage, children exhibit basic mathematical behaviors, yet their grasp of mathematical concepts remains limited. This phase underscores the importance of tailored educational approaches that bridge the perceptual-abstract gap. Play-based and concrete learning experiences prove invaluable in nurturing a foundational numerical sense during this developmental stage. The concrete operational stage emerges as a critical phase for elementary math learning, characterized by substantial growth in mathematical abilities and logical reasoning. This period presents a golden opportunity for educators to engage students in more complex mathematical tasks and cultivate a profound understanding of fundamental mathematical concepts. Although the formal operational stage does not directly correspond to elementary math learning, it serves as the bedrock for advanced mathematical thinking. It empowers students with abstract thinking abilities that find application in complex mathematical theories and problem-solving at higher educational levels. Throughout this journey, our study underscores the paramount importance of aligning instructional methods with children’s cognitive development stages. By recognizing the distinctive attributes and requirements of students at various developmental phases, educators can optimize the math learning experience and nurture mathematical proficiency. This study offers a comprehensive exploration of the interplay between cognitive development and elementary math learning, providing valuable insights for educators and curriculum designers. Understanding how children progress through these cognitive stages is pivotal in fostering mathematical literacy and empowering students to confidently navigate the realm of mathematics.
